  • Now subtitled in dozens of languages! Wonderful 30-minute White Tara teaching: how to practice, including visualizations - with the profound practice of five-colour healing light - from Venerable Zasep Rinpoche, with animated visualization graphics.
    Rinpoche instructs on how to visualize, how to self-generate as White Tara (for those with initiation; those without empowerment should visualize Tara in front of themselves). He then describes the healing light filling the body, then the careful layered protection "tents" in the five colors (and what they signify). He explains how to chant the mantra and visualize the healing energy.
    The mantra:
    OM TARE TUTTARE TURE MAMA AYU PUNYE JNANA PUSHTIM KURU SOHA
    Some quotes from video: "When you practice White Tara... you are also creating good karma... it purifies unwholesome karmas of your past..." Rinpoche then instructs in the details of the visualizations: "First you visualize a lotus moon cushion, then you visualize a white TAM syllable." (Accompanied by visualizations graphics)... "The white TAM slowly gets bigger, slowly merging with yourself... transforms into White Tara. I, myself, become White Tara... I am holding a blue uptala flower in my left hand with my hand in the mudra of the Buddhas of the three times... I, myself, as White Tara, am the embodiment of the Buddhas of the past, present and future... White Tara has seven eyes... one eye on the forehead, wisdom eye, then one eye in each palm of the hand... and the bottom of the feet..." He goes on to describe visualizing the mantra surrounding a White TAM syllable at your heart, and the white light filling your body, healing energy. "While you're repeating White Tara mantra, imagine your entire body is filled with white light... the light of longevity and good health.

      Yes you can practice the White Tara mantra without transmission. It is, always, better to have transmission. However, without full empowerment (not just lung or transmission of the mantra) you can only front-generate White Tara -- which means visualize her in front of you with yourself prostrating and making offerings to her. You cannot, without empowerment, visualize yourself as White Tara. The mantra, however, is fine to chant without empowerment of lung until such time as you have the opportunity to receive it.
